I've found that embracing a creative outlet, such as collecting and using stationery, can be a therapeutic way to cope with tough emotional struggles like depression and loneliness. For me, the habit of organizing my thoughts and plans using a planner—especially a motivational one like the 'DO MORE OF WHAT YOU LOVE 2026 PLANNER'—adds structure and positivity to my days. Writing down daily goals and gratitude notes not only helps me stay focused but also lifts my mood. The tactile feel of pens, pencils, and paper offers a comforting sensory experience I look forward to. While it started as an addiction that felt overwhelming, I now channel this habit into something productive and calming. If you find yourself battling similar feelings, I recommend trying out journaling or planning with appealing stationery. It might seem small, but having a creative and routine activity can contribute to mental wellness. Remember, these habits can evolve into meaningful self-care practices, providing happiness and a sense of accomplishment amid challenges.
